Defence University Visits Institute

A delegation from the Zimbabwe National Defence University academic and administration departments visited the Harare Institute of Technology to familiarize with the Institute's administration and academic operations.

In his introductory remarks, the leader of the delegation, Group Captain J. Malete said the purpose of their visit was to learn about the University's administration and academic operations. "As you are aware that we are in the process of establishing the Zimbabwe National Defence University, we are here to learn about the academic and operations of other local universities," he said.

HIT Registrar, Mrs Mary Samupindi took them through the Institute's main administrative and academic operations and processes, while Mr. J.L. Maenzanise also explained the operations and services offered by the Institute Library. Mrs. M. Chahuruva also apprised the group of the Institute's Information Communications Technologies department operations and services.

The group also visited the Registration, Admissions and Students Record and Examinations departments.
